Awareness-Enabled Coordination

Abstract

Many of the technologies and software products that have been developed to support virtual team collaboration have problems with scaling upwards. While some existing technologies support many users, they provide only limited help for users and virtual teams to deal with the complexity of the environment they operate in. The Awareness-Enabled Coordination (AEC) project is to improve support for (large scale) collaboration between intelligence gathering organizations and CT analysts. This is accomplished by providing tools and services that increase the efficiency of collaborative work, especially cross-agency collaborative work, while minimizing the overhead and learning curve necessary to use these tools and services.
